ABSTRACT
By leveraging efficient deposition-dissolution process at Sn anode and reversible solid-to-solid conversion of Ag to AgCl at AgNWs/CNT hybrid cathode, the decoupled Sn–Ag cell design improves the cycling stability in traditional Ag-based batteries.
